What is multiplication?
Back
Multiplication is a mathematical operation where a number is added to itself a certain number of times. For example, 3 multiplied by 4 (3 x 4) means adding 3 four times: 3 + 3 + 3 + 3 = 12.

What is a factor?
Back
A factor is a number that divides another number without leaving a remainder. For example, in the equation 7 x 6 = 42, both 7 and 6 are factors of 42.

What is the product in multiplication?
Back
The product is the result of multiplying two or more numbers together. For example, the product of 5 and 3 is 15 (5 x 3 = 15).

What does the distributive property state?
Back
The distributive property states that a(b + c) = ab + ac. This means you can distribute a number across a sum inside parentheses.

What is a number pattern?
Back
A number pattern is a sequence of numbers that follow a specific rule or formula. For example, the pattern 2, 4, 6, 8 increases by 2 each time.

What is division?
Back
Division is a mathematical operation where a number is split into equal parts. For example, 12 divided by 3 (12 ÷ 3) means splitting 12 into 3 equal parts, which equals 4.

What is a quotient?
Back
The quotient is the result of a division operation. For example, in 20 ÷ 4 = 5, the quotient is 5.
